Misconceptions About Doubts:
1. Doubt is the opposite of _faith_.
- Unbelief is the opposite of faith.
- Unbelief refers to a willful refusal to believe.
- Doubt refers to an inner uncertainty.
2. Doubt is _unforgivable_.
- God is big enough to handle all our doubts, so He never condemns us when we question Him.
3. Doubt means we lack _any_ faith.
- Struggling WITH God is a sure sign we have faith.
- If we never struggle, our faith will never grow strong.
Three Examples of Believers Doubts And The Response.
1. A father’s doubt (We may doubt but Jesus _acts_)
-Mark 9:22-24
Faith intermingled with doubt, and yet, Jesus performs the miracle anyway.
Pastor’s Side-note:
•Evidently, mingled faith mattered more than doubt because Jesus doesn’t even rebuke him- He simply heals the boy.
2. A prophet’s doubt (We may doubt but Jesus _affirms_)
-Matthew 11:2–5
-Matthew 11:11
3. A disciple’s doubt (We may doubt but Jesus _accepts_)
“Doubting Thomas”
- He possessed enormous courage
-John 11:16
- He was an intentional follower of Jesus.
-John 14:5
He was a wounded believer- not unwilling but unable.
-John 20:27-28
